How to Use Partnership for Homeownership

  • What is the Partnership for Homeownership? You may have heard people mention the WHEDA Home Loan. Partnership for Homeownership is a special kind of WHEDA Home Loan. WHEDA will provide you with a first mortgage loan and Rural Development will provide a second mortgage loan. The Rural Development loan is typically a significant amount of the purchase price of your Home.


  • You get the benefit of low interest rates on both your WHEDA first mortgage loan and your Rural Development second mortgage loan. You also aren't required to pay for mortgage insurance, an insurance most WHEDA borrowers pay because their loan amounts are a large percentage of the sales price of the Home. What does all this mean? It means you'll have more affordable payments than you thought possible!


  • All Partnership for Homeownership applications begin with Rural Development, part of the United States Department of Agriculture. They will put together the loan application materials for you and send you to one of our participating lenders. Your lender will make sure you have everything you need for your WHEDA loan approval and send your application to us. Find a Rural Development-USDA office near you to get started.
